Definition of Pigeonholes

noun

  1. One of an array of compartments for housing pigeons.
  2. One of an array of compartments for receiving mail and other messages at a college, office, etc.

    "Fred was disappointed to find his pigeonhole empty except for bills and a flyer offering 20% off on manicures."

  3. One of an array of compartments for storing scrolls at a library.
  4. A similar compartment in a desk, used for sorting and storing papers.

verb

  1. To categorize; especially to limit or be limited to a particular category, role, etc.

    "Fred was tired of being pigeonholed as a computer geek."

  2. To put aside, to not act on (proposals, suggestions, advice).
